Abstract: The hypoxia-inducible factor (Hif)-1α (Hif-1α) and Hif-2α (Epas1) have a critical role in both normal development and cancer. von Hippel Lindau (Vhl) protein, encoded by a tumor suppressor gene, is an E3 ubiquitin ligase that targets Hif-1α and Epas1 to the proteasome for degradation. To better understand the role of Vhl in the biology of mesenchymal cells, we analyzed mutant mice lacking Vhl in mesenchymal progenitors that give rise to the soft tissues that form and surround synovial joints. Loss of Vhl in mesenchymal progenitors of the limb bud caused severe fibrosis of the synovial joints and formation of aggressive masses with histologic features of mesenchymal tumors. Hif-1α and its downstream target connective tissue growth factor were necessary for the development of these tumors, which conversely still developed in the absence of Epas1, but at lower frequency. Human tumors of the soft tissue are a very complex and heterogeneous group of neoplasias. Our novel findings in genetically altered mice suggest that activation of the HIF signaling pathway could be an important pathogenetic event in the development and progression of at least a subset of these tumors.

Abstract: In this paper, we derive the unpolarized infrared (IR) emissivity of thin oil films over anisotropic Gaussian seas from a refined physical surface spectrum model of damping due to oil. Since the electromagnetic wavelength is much smaller than the surface mean curvature radius and than the surface root mean square height, the Kirchhoff-tangent plane approximation, reduced to the geometric optics approximation, can be used. The surface can then be replaced by its local infinite tangent plane at each point of each rough surface. The multiple reflections at each interface are ignored (i.e., for both the upper air/oil interface and the lower oil/sea interface of the contaminated sea). Nevertheless, the multiple reflections between the upper and the lower interfaces of the oil film are taken into account, by assuming a locally flat and planar thin oil film, which forms a local Fabry-Perot interferometer. This means that the Fresnel reflection coefficient of a single interface can be substituted for the equivalent Fresnel reflection coefficient of the air/oil/sea film, calculated by considering an infinite number of reflections inside the layer. Comparisons of the emissivity between a clean sea and a contaminated sea are presented, with respect to emission angle, wind speed, wind direction, oil film thickness, oil type, and wavelength. Thus, oil detection, characterization, and quantization are investigated in the IR window regions.

Abstract: This study identifies three perspectives of accountability in charitable organizations: agency, stewardship, and stakeholder in relation to the availability of financial information. To examine current accountability practices, 75 interviews and informal conversations were undertaken with participants in charities in New Zealand. Many of the interviewees operated under some form of stewardship milieu. They regarded the need to discharge accountability by providing financial information as a low priority. Education may provide a way to resolve this issue by advancing stakeholders’ perspectives of accountability. This could result in reduced support for charities that do not uphold a certain standard of financial information.

Abstract: Resume Introduction Les principaux effets secondaires des biotherapies anti-TNF alpha sont maintenant bien connus, notamment le risque d’infections opportunistes. Certains effets paradoxaux sont plus exceptionnellement decrits, tels que le developpement de reactions granulomateuses de type sarcoidose. Observation Nous rapportons ici l’observation d’une femme de 39 ans suivie pour une polyarthrite rhumatoide severe traitee par etanercept depuis cinq ans, hospitalisee en urgence pour vomissements et douleurs abdominales diffuses revelant une hypercalcemie majeure avec insuffisance renale aigue. Apres correction des troubles metaboliques sous hydratation et biphosphonates, le scanner thoracoabdominopelvien a montre la presence d’un syndrome interstitiel bilateral et d’une volumineuse splenomegalie heterogene. Le diagnostic de sarcoidose a ete confirme par les biopsies bronchiques perendoscopiques. L’evolution a ete favorable apres l’arret de l’etanercept et une corticotherapie a doses decroissantes. Conclusion Le risque de sarcoidose induite doit etre connu chez les patients sous anti-TNF et doit etre evoque en cas d’hypercalcemie majeure et/ou de splenomegalie.
